I am memorializing this for my own benefit here. Benefitting from https://eng-blog.iij.ad.jp/archives/12576 I see that I don't need to change any envars, but only fonts.
The default Lucida Console font renders CJK as half-width chars, on this PC with 3 Windows language packs. With MS ゴシック, Japanese かな and 漢字 look good. Traditional Chinese ㄅㄛˋㄆㄛˋㄇㄛˋand 漢字 look good. Korean 한글 doesn't look good. It looks like they're half-width characters drawn with the space for one full-width character.
